Thanksgiving Feast Could Be More Affordable in 2024: Turkey Prices Hint at a Cheaper Holiday

Thanksgiving, a time for family, friends, and a mountain of delicious food, often comes with a hefty price tag. But there's a glimmer of hope on the horizon for budget-conscious families this year. Early indications suggest that turkey prices, a major component of the Thanksgiving meal, could be dropping in 2024, potentially making the holiday feast more affordable for many.

The potential price decrease isn't just a wishful thought; several factors are contributing to the optimism. Experts point to increased turkey production as a primary driver. After a period of higher prices due to various factors including increased feed costs and avian flu outbreaks, turkey farmers are now reporting healthier flocks and increased output. This increased supply is expected to alleviate the pressure on prices, making turkeys more accessible to consumers.

Furthermore, the overall economic climate is playing a role. While inflation remains a concern, the current trajectory suggests a potential easing of price pressures on various goods, including food staples. This broader economic trend could further contribute to lower turkey prices, creating a more favorable environment for Thanksgiving shoppers.

However, it's crucial to temper expectations. While a price drop is anticipated, it's unlikely to be a dramatic reduction. The cost of other Thanksgiving essentials, such as cranberries, stuffing ingredients, and pumpkin pie, will still need to be factored into the overall budget. Other unforeseen circumstances, such as unexpected weather events affecting crop yields, could also impact prices.

What can consumers do to prepare for a potentially cheaper, but still delicious, Thanksgiving?

  • Shop around: Comparing prices from different grocery stores and retailers is crucial to securing the best deals. Look for sales and discounts, and don't hesitate to explore alternative options like buying in bulk or purchasing frozen turkeys.
  • Plan your menu strategically: Consider incorporating less expensive side dishes to balance out the cost of the turkey. Potentially, explore using alternative proteins alongside or instead of turkey, such as chicken or vegetarian options.
  • Start early: Begin your Thanksgiving shopping early to take advantage of early bird discounts and avoid potential shortages closer to the holiday.
  • Consider homegrown options: If possible, growing your own vegetables or herbs can significantly reduce the overall cost of your Thanksgiving meal.

While the promise of a cheaper Thanksgiving meal in 2024 is encouraging, consumers should remain proactive in their planning and shopping. By taking advantage of price comparisons, strategic menu planning, and early shopping, families can enjoy a delicious and affordable Thanksgiving celebration, regardless of the final turkey price tag.
